OpenHand allows you to dial in to your network remotely via a laptop or PocketPC, to access and update your email, calendar, contacts and tasks. OpenHand gives you the option of working in real-time, or downloading the information to your device and working offline.

If you choose to work in real-time, the information is not stored on the mobile device – it is held only on your organisation’s server. This means there is no risk to your information if your device is lost or stolen, and that the information is updated in realtime on your servers.

Alternatively, OpenHand allows you to store emails, calendar items, contacts and tasks locally on the device. These files can then be accessed and edited when you are offline (they are also accessible when working online), and uploaded when you next connect. Unlike synchronisation, which transfers all files, OpenHand allows you to save only the required files.
